According to The Pitch Prospect, Bournemouth expect Antoine Semenyo’s move to Manchester City to be formalized in the next 48 hours.
Clubs held positive discussions today over the structure of payments that will trigger the winger’s release clause of £60m plus add-ons.

Semenyo has already verbally agreed personal terms with City as he preferred a move there over other Premier League teams.
He is currently expected to feature in Bournemouth’s game against Chelsea on Tuesday, in what could be his farewell appearance.
The Blues were desperate to make a move but backed out for Semenyo, who is now close to a move to the Etihad Stadium.
Liverpool, Manchester United and Tottenham Hotspur have also been linked with the Ghana international.
The Pitch Prospect had previously reported that his release clause must be activated in the first ten days of the transfer window.

Semenyo’s season so far
After scoring 13 goals and assisting seven more goals in all competitions last season, Semenyo has made a great start to the current campaign.
He scored twice in the opening game against Liverpool, although Bournemouth lost 4-2 at Anfield.
